Day 02: Drive to Tarashing via Astore
On this Day
Leave Chilas and take the Karakoram Highway to the Astore turnoff near Jaglot. Enter Astore Valley along the Astore River, going through settlements, agricultural terraces, and sheer mountain walls. Continue via Astore and Gorikot before taking the beautiful route to Tarashing, the main entrance to Rupal Valley. Arrive beneath the southern slopes of Nanga Parbat, check into a modest hotel, and enjoy the rural scenery. Overnight stay in Tarashing.
Day 03: Rupal Valley Excursion
On this Day
Explore Tarashing and journey deeper into Rupal Valley with a local guide, following the trail to Rupal town and nearby mountain vistas. Walk past traditional towns, agriculture, streams, and open meadows, all framed by the massive Rupal Face of Nanga Parbat. View the Tarashing Glacier area from secure vantage points and learn about native alpine life. After the valley adventure, return to Tarashing for some relaxing exploring and shooting. Overnight stay in Tarashing.
Day 04: Lower Rupal Face Trip and Viewpoints
On this Day
Continue exploring Tarashing's upper environs with a guided trip along the lower Rupal Face trekking trail. Follow reasonable sections toward the meadows and overlooks that lead to Herrligkoffer Base Camp, rather than trying the entire walk. Enjoy panoramic views of glaciers, rocky ridges, grazing areas, and Nanga Parbat's southern wall. After the expedition, return to Tarashing along the same route and enjoy a relaxing village walk with mountain views. This is our third overnight stay in Tarashing.
Day 05: Drive back to Chilas
On this Day
Depart Tarashing and follow the mountain road through Gorikot to Astore. Stop at various locations for a different perspective on the valley's communities, including the river, terraced fields, and surrounding peaks. Continue to the Karakoram Highway near Jaglot, then follow the Indus corridor south to Chilas. The return trip combines village landscape with spectacular bare mountains and steep canyons. Arrive in Chilas, settle into your hotel, and recover before returning to Islamabad.
Day 06: Drive to Islamabad
On this Day
Leave Chilas and continue the last overland journey to Islamabad via the Indus River and Karakoram Highway. Pass through Kohistan's mountain communities, small valleys, and steep gorges before continuing to Besham, Mansehra, Abbottabad, and the Hazara region. Suitable stops allow passengers to rest and appreciate the scenery along the way. The terrain progressively transitions from high, arid mountains to greener foothills and metropolitan areas. Arrive at Islamabad, where the six-day Rupal Valley Tour ends.

Overview – Rupal Valley Tour
The Rupal Valley Tour showcases one of Gilgit-Baltistan’s most stunning Himalayan landscapes beneath Nanga Parbat’s imposing southern face. The journey begins in Astore Valley and continues to Tarashing, the primary entry to this inaccessible alpine region. Along the way, travelers will see winding rivers, agricultural terraces, traditional towns, and craggy peaks. Furthermore, Tarashing provides serene surroundings and breathtaking views of glaciers, meadows, and towering mountain cliffs. Furthermore, changing scenery makes each part of the voyage visually interesting. As a result, the tour is ideal for nature enthusiasts, photographers, families, and travelers looking for quieter sites outside of Pakistan’s well-known northern roads.
Visitors to the Rupal Valley can discover village pathways and views that overlook the breathtaking Rupal Face. In addition, guided treks highlight alpine pastures, glacier landscapes, pristine streams, and the valley’s unique rural lifestyle. Nanga Parbat, at 8,126 metres, serves as the Himalayas’ western anchor point. Meanwhile, the vast mountain backdrop provides ideal conditions for landscape photography and unique outdoor adventures. Although deeper routes necessitate hiking experience, shorter excursions are accessible to many active travelers.
